Chrome plating, or chromium electroplating, is a surface finishing technique that applies a thin layer of chromium onto metal or plastic substrates to enhance corrosion resistance, hardness, wear resistance, and aesthetic appeal. In Germany, this process is widely applied across automotive, mechanical engineering, aerospace, and decorative industries, supporting both industrial and consumer applications.

The Germany chrome plating industry combines technical expertise, environmental responsibility, and high-quality output, making it a benchmark for efficient and sustainable surface finishing practices in Europe and globally.

In the automotive sector, chrome plating is used for bumpers, trims, engine parts, and wheels, providing durability and a polished finish. Decorative chrome plating is also prevalent in household appliances, furniture, sanitary fittings, and hardware, where aesthetics and protection are critical.

Germany’s chrome plating industry is strongly influenced by strict European Union environmental regulations, particularly restrictions on hexavalent chromium (Cr⁶⁺) due to its toxicity and carcinogenic nature. As a result, trivalent chromium (Cr³⁺) plating and advanced waste treatment and recycling technologies have been widely adopted. These innovations ensure compliance, enhance worker safety, and minimize ecological impact.

The market is driven by Germany’s automotive leadership, high industrial standards, and demand for precision-engineered components. Technological advancements, including eco-friendly plating processes, automation, and digital quality monitoring, are further enhancing efficiency and competitiveness.

Major chrome plating hubs include Baden-Württemberg, Bavaria, and North Rhine-Westphalia, where numerous automotive, industrial, and decorative plating facilities operate to serve domestic and export markets. Challenges include high compliance costs, energy consumption, and skilled labor requirements, which are addressed through innovation and sustainable practices.
